We have an exciting opportunity for a HGV Team Leader to join our team at Florette in Lichfield, WS13 8NF. This role will be responsible for on‑road HGV driver accountabilities, overseeing the day‑to‑day activities of HGV drivers to ensure a safe and compliant operation. Be accountable for assessing driver performance, developing driver skills, and enforcing adherence to legal and company transport standards.

Working hours: Night shifts on a 4 on 4 off pattern, 3am/4am start, 12 hours shifts.

Pay: Circa £45,000.

Main Responsibilities:

  • Conduct practical and theoretical assessments of HGV drivers to evaluate competence and identify development needs; implement targeted training and development strategies to enhance performance, safety and efficiency; coach and mentor drivers, providing constructive feedback to maintain and raise high standards.
  • Ensure all HGV drivers comply with road traffic laws, transport regulations and company policies; monitor and enforce adherence to safety protocols and maintain up to date records in the transport management system.
  • Support the investigation of incidents, accidents and non‑compliance with HGV regulations, recommending and assisting with the implementation of corrective actions.
  • Set clear performance expectations for drivers and monitor KPI’s related to safety, efficiency and compliance; prepare regular management reports on driver performance, incidents and development initiatives to support continuous improvement and operational accountability.
  • Assist in managing sickness absence, including return to work interviews and provide support with disciplinary matters in line with HR guidance; address under performance through positive support, coaching, additional training where necessary, initiating formal action in accordance with procedure and guidance from HR when required.
  • Assist with the recruitment of HGV drivers in line with the Company’s recruitment process; oversee temporary workers to ensure they perform to the required standards and meet business operational needs.
  • Evaluate the performance of the team using the Company’s appraisal system, including personal development plans; ensure the team is trained and competent, identifying ongoing training needs to enhance skills and knowledge.

Skills and Experience Required:

  • A clean C&E (Class 1) Licence with a minimum of 5 years Class 1 driving experience on UK roads, preferably in food manufacturing or FMCG.
  • A strong understanding of transport regulations and HGV regulations.
  • In depth knowledge of HGV operation and road safety regulations.
  • Ability to train and coach individuals effectively, with excellent communication skills.
  • Demonstratable people leadership skills, with the ability to motivate, inspire and guide teams to achieve their goals.
  • Competent user of Microsoft Office and transport management systems.
